Clera - Your AI talent agent
LoginStart
Start
FL
Foresite Labs (Stealth Co)

Senior Staff Engineer, Middleware and Orchestration

full-time•San Diego•$200k - $215k

Summary

Location

San Diego

Salary

$200k - $215k

Type

full-time

Experience

10+ years

Company links

WebsiteLinkedInLinkedIn

About this role

Senior Staff Engineer, Middleware and Orchestration

Location: San Diego, CA

Job Type: Full-Time

Pay Range: $200k - $215k

About Us

We are a venture-backed, stealth-stage biotechnology company based in San Diego, focused on developing novel technologies that will redefine how disease is detected, characterized, and managed with a novel approach to clinical genomics. Our mission is to fundamentally transform healthcare through a convergence of innovation across multiple scientific disciplines.

Founded by industry veterans with decades of experience in life sciences tools and diagnostics, our leadership team brings a proven track record of translating scientific insight into successful commercial products. Our investors include some of the most respected names in healthcare and deep tech.

Position Overview

We are looking for a Senior Staff Middleware & Orchestration Engineer to design and implement the orchestration layers that coordinate this system reliably and deterministically. This role overlaps low-level embedded control and high-level application software. You will own middleware responsible for system orchestration, workflow management, and EtherCAT-based real-time coordination, enabling higher-level teams to build features without needing to understand the full complexity of the underlying hardware. This is a deeply technical, hands-on role that combines real-time distributed systems, fieldbus technology, and software architecture. You will work closely with embedded firmware, controls, robotics, and systems engineers.

Key Responsibilities

Orchestration & Middleware Architecture

  • Design and implement orchestration middleware for a complex distributed embedded

    system

  • Develop high-level scheduling, workflow management, and coordination layers

  • Define clear abstractions that bridge real-time embedded systems and higher-level

    application logic

  • Ensure deterministic behavior, synchronization, and fault handling across many nodes

  • Architect middleware that scales as system size and complexity grow

EtherCAT Master & Bus Management

  • Own EtherCAT master integration and development

  • Bring up, configure, and manage EtherCAT chains in real hardware

  • Implement and maintain EtherCAT stack components, including:

    • Device discovery and configuration

    • Hot-connect/hot-group management

  • Troubleshoot EtherCAT timing, synchronization, and communication issues

  • Work directly with hardware, firmware, and field wiring during system bring-up

System Bring-Up & Debugging

  • Lead EtherCAT chain bring-up from first connection through stable operation

  • Diagnose and resolve issues involving distributed clocks, topology, and bus errors

  • Develop tooling and diagnostics for EtherCAT visibility and debugging

  • Collaborate closely with firmware and hardware engineers during integration

State Machines & System Control

  • Design and implement robust state machines for complex systems

  • Coordinate transitions across multiple distributes subsystems

  • Handle error states, recovery paths, and partial system availability

  • Apply best practices from robotics, automation, and medical Platforms

APIs & Cross-functional Enablement

  • Develop Python APIs that expose orchestration in a usable, intuitive way

  • Implement performance-critical middleware layers in C/C++, with Python bindings

    where appropriate

  • Enable application, test and automation teams to interact with the system safely and

    effectively

  • Balance usability, performance, and determination in API design

Qualifications

Education:

 BS/MS in Computer Science or Engineering

Required:

Experience & Technical Skills

  • 7+ years of experience in middleware, embedded systems, robotics, or distributed control software

  • Hands-on experience with EtherCAT master and EtherCAT stack development or other

    similar fieldbus technologies (required)

  • Proven experience bringing up and managing EtherCAT networks or similar fieldbus

    networks on real hardware

  • Strong experience designing orchestration or coordination layers for distributed systems

  • Expertise in C/C++ and Python

Real-Time & Distributed Knowledge

  • Deep understanding of real-time constraints and synchronized systems

  • Experience with distributed clocks, deterministic scheduling, and bus timing

  • Strong background in designing and implementing complex state machines

  • Familiarity with robotics, industrial automation, or medical device platforms

Debugging & Integration Skills

  • Comfortable debugging across software, firmware, and physical bus layers

  • Ability to reason from logs, bus traces, and hardware behavior

  • Experience working cross-functionally with firmware, hardware, and application teams

Preferred:

  • Experience with ROS, ROS2, or similar robotics frameworks

  • Familiarity with safety-critical or regulated systems

  • Experience building simulation or test frameworks for distributed systems

  • Background in controls or motion systems

Why Join Us

  • Work in a dynamic, collaborative environment where innovation and scientific rigor are

    deeply valued.

  • Join a seasoned and multidisciplinary team tackling high-impact problems at the

    intersection of science and engineering.

  • Competitive compensation and equity package, comprehensive benefits, and flexibility to support work-life integration.

We are an equal opportunity employer. We thrive on diversity and collaboration.

What you'll do

  • Design and implement orchestration middleware for a complex distributed embedded system, ensuring deterministic behavior and fault handling. Collaborate with firmware and hardware engineers during system integration and debugging.

About Foresite Labs (Stealth Co)

Foresite Labs creates companies at the intersection of AI/machine learning and science. We believe AI, generative AI, and data science—when applied with scientific rigor—can accelerate discovery and drive innovations that benefit humanity. We provide the foundation for bold ideas to take shape and accelerate, shaping a better future for all. We offer competitive salaries, excellent benefits, and a flexible work environment where employees learn from top thinkers across multiple disciplines. With headquarters in San Francisco and Boston, we’re building a culture where scientific rigor meets entrepreneurial ambition. Foresite Labs Values Truth over progression: We follow the science, pursuing ideas that are grounded in data and abandoning them when not supported by the evidence. Take good risks: Our culture values informed risk-taking: good decisions are celebrated even when they result in bad outcomes. Everyone feels safe to contribute ideas and to learn from failure. Single accountable person: The project team lead is accountable for all decisions and for maintaining transparency and information flow within the team; we trust the project teams. The Review Committee unlocks capital and sets directions. Simplicity and Focus: “Companies die from indigestion, not starvation” (Bill Hewlett) We will focus on a few ideas aggressively and minimize all other distractions. Everyone will have a few key goals that have measurable outcomes. Respect and Community: Our employees are our greatest asset; everyone invests in creating an environment of collaboration and respect. We support their careers and career development whether they stay, go to a Labs company, or end up somewhere else.

Ready to join Foresite Labs (Stealth Co)?

Take the next step in your career journey

Frequently Asked Questions

What does Foresite Labs (Stealth Co) pay for a Senior Staff Engineer, Middleware and Orchestration?

Toggle
Foresite Labs (Stealth Co) offers a competitive compensation package for the Senior Staff Engineer, Middleware and Orchestration role. The salary range is USD 200k - 215k per year. Apply through Clera to learn more about the full compensation details.

What does a Senior Staff Engineer, Middleware and Orchestration do at Foresite Labs (Stealth Co)?

Toggle
As a Senior Staff Engineer, Middleware and Orchestration at Foresite Labs (Stealth Co), you will: design and implement orchestration middleware for a complex distributed embedded system, ensuring deterministic behavior and fault handling. Collaborate with firmware and hardware engineers during system integration and debugging..

Is the Senior Staff Engineer, Middleware and Orchestration position at Foresite Labs (Stealth Co) remote?

Toggle
The Senior Staff Engineer, Middleware and Orchestration position at Foresite Labs (Stealth Co) is based in San Diego, California, United States. Contact the company through Clera for specific work arrangement details.

How do I apply for the Senior Staff Engineer, Middleware and Orchestration position at Foresite Labs (Stealth Co)?

Toggle
You can apply for the Senior Staff Engineer, Middleware and Orchestration position at Foresite Labs (Stealth Co) directly through Clera. Click the "Apply Now" button above to start your application. Clera's AI-powered platform will help match your profile with this opportunity and guide you through the application process.
Clera - Your AI talent agent
© 2026 Clera Labs, Inc.TermsPrivacyHelp

Join Clera's Talent Pool

Get matched with similar opportunities at top startups

This role is hosted on Foresite Labs (Stealth Co)'s careers site.
Join our talent pool first to get notified about similar roles that match your profile.